The universities are concluding a cooperation agreement regarding their future partnership. Building on a wide range of existing projects, this will consolidate and expand the collaboration between the two institutions.
The Rector of the University of Cologne, Professor Dr Joybrato Mukherjee, and the President of New York University (NYU), Professor Dr Linda G. Mills, signed a cooperation agreement in New York yesterday that encompasses a strategic partnership in the fields of research and teaching, exchange opportunities for academics and students, and joint educational and research events. The two universities intend to promote and expand cooperation between them, which includes holding regular meetings to coordinate, organize, evaluate, and advance their joint activities.
Rector Professor Dr Joybrato Mukherjee said: “This new partnership brings together two major, research-intensive universities to open up new opportunities for collaboration and exchange for researchers and students. This benefits both sides and strengthens our transatlantic network. I would like to thank everyone involved who carried out the essential groundwork and thus made this agreement possible.”
NYU President Linda G. Mills said: “The signing of this agreement signifies an exciting new partnership between our universities, as we make a mutual commitment to collaborative research and create new pathways for exchange. We thank our partners at the University of Cologne and everyone who labored behind the scenes to make today possible.”
The signing took place at the Elmer Holmes Bobst Library at NYU. Alongside Professor Mukherjee, the University of Cologne was also represented at the signing ceremony by the former Vice-Rector for International Affairs, Professor Dr Johanna Hey, and the Head of the University of Cologne’s Liaison Office in North America, Dr Eva Bosbach.
The University of Cologne and NYU are already collaborating on a wide range of research projects in the humanities, natural sciences, law, and economic and social sciences. A symposium that will bring together plant scientists from both institutions is currently being planned to launch the activities under the partnership agreement. This is expected to take place in Cologne in May 2027.
